Output 660ad0428d67562d6c3cd59cdd8998e430f0cc21cadd1d2144626da0feff2f24:1

value
23346673
script pubkey
OP_0 OP_PUSHBYTES_20 57ff4e314c4d27b79684086ba0ca1d06b1cf7b6a
address
ltc1q2ll5uv2vf5nm095ypp46pjsaq6cu77m2xm63mn
transaction
660ad0428d67562d6c3cd59cdd8998e430f0cc21cadd1d2144626da0feff2f24
spent
true